I have varying levels of movement across all of my 1911's. My CBOB is pretty tight, my Springfield MilSpec sounds like a maraca when you shake it. But, it's my understanding that the bushing to barrel fitting is far more important than slide to frame. I fit a new bushing in my MilSpec and it's more accurate than all the others that cost far more.
